Paradise Lost, a PolyAmorous Debut Title

Paradise Lost, a PolyAmorous title gets its March 24 release date. All in! Games just revealed that their latest game will be coming to PC, PlayStation 4, and Xbox One.

The All in! Games press release reads:

“What happened in the bunker? WWII had no victor, leaving the heart of Europe hidden behind a veil of radiation, transformed into a nuclear wasteland by the Nazis. As Szymon, a recently orphaned 12-year-old wandering the wasteland, you come across a massive, abandoned bunker. From deep inside, a mysterious girl, Ewa, contacts Szymon via the bunker’s intercoms—who is she and what are her intentions? Will you uncover the secrets of the past?”

This is PolyAmorous’s first game, and this Warsaw developer has got an interesting first-person thriller mystery game on their hands. Or so it seems. The game was first teased back in May last year when All in! Games posted a cinematic teaser on their official YouTube channel.

We don’t know much else at the present, but given the fact we’ll be playing Paradise Lost in just a couple of weeks, that’s okay. The game seems to be an “under-the-radar” type of title which is fine if it can deliver once you boot it up.

PolyAmorous, the developer behind Paradise Lost worked, in part, on Killzone, Ryze, and a couple of other AAA titles. They also won an Unreal Dev Grant in 2018. The prize is offered by Epic Games. Paradise Lost is their first independent title, but given their history and their resume, that delivery is highly likely.
